Transaction 62d0cc51fa730bc3cdcdc1d97e0dfc1fb12abcb4c32cb785bf49bbc872e86966

2 Input
2 Outputs
  • 62d0cc51fa730bc3cdcdc1d97e0dfc1fb12abcb4c32cb785bf49bbc872e86966:0
  • value  2358723
    address  34P8EjDEwMK4cDChWUNWB9KoPVC3T5GKvc
  • 62d0cc51fa730bc3cdcdc1d97e0dfc1fb12abcb4c32cb785bf49bbc872e86966:1
  • value  740699
    address  1FNMkApTQqRDrmpyfTtn8FbbvnjcDyfD4k